Sudi region backs Khang’ati in race to unseat Lusaka


The race to unseat Bungoma Governor Kenneth Lusaka has intensified eight months to the election. The governor’s top political rival is former Kanduyi MP Alfred Khang’ati, who is said to have gained massive support of the Sudi region. Sudi is the southern part of Bungoma county, named after pre-colonial paramount chief Sudi Namachanja. On Sunday, Khang’ati met 300 opinion leaders from Kanduyi and Bumula constituencies in Bungoma town, where they pledged to support his bid. The leaders accused Lusaka of doing little with the more than Sh30 billion the county has received since 2013.
